About
Dr. Jennifer Wilhelm is a board-certified internal medicine physician with over 20 years of experience caring for patients in Western North Carolina. She graduated Magna Cum Laude from Vanderbilt University in 1995 with a bachelor's degree in Mathematics, then earned her medical degree from the University of Tennessee College of Medicine in 1999. The faculty there recognized her with membership in Alpha Omega Alpha, the country's highest medical honor society. She completed her internship and residency in internal medicine at Thomas Jefferson University Hospital in Philadelphia.
Dr. Wilhelm moved to Asheville in 2002 and spent years at Pardee Hospital Internal Medicine Associates and Advent Health before joining PrimeHealth Asheville in 2022. She focuses on disease prevention and wellness promotion, working as a health advocate who partners closely with each patient. She lives in South Asheville with her husband David, their two teenage children, and their rescue black lab, Bo.
